WebWhen we add two positive numbers, the result will always be a positive number. Hence, on adding positive numbers direction of movement will always be to the right side. For example, addition of 1 and 5 (1 + 5 = 6) Here the first number is 1 and the second number is 5; both are positive. First, locate 1 on the number line. WebSolution: 7x+3<5x+9 Simplifying the above equation, 2x<6 or x<3 Now, we have the final answer as x<3. Thus, we can plot this solution on the number line in the following way. Draw a number line using a scale and pencil. Put arrows at the end of the line. These arrows show that the line is infinite. WebNow an inequality uses a greater than, less than symbol, and all that we have to do to graph an inequality is find the the number, '3' in this case and color in everything above or below it. Just remember. if the symbol is (≥ or ≤) then you fill in the dot, like the top two examples in the graph below. if the symbol is (> or <) then you do ...
